    Ilya's soft leather boots dig into the dirt of the fortress ground as he comes to a stop, levelling his bow at the Stag Lord through the chaos of the fight. He lets loose two arrows in quick succession. The first pierces the bandit's right shoulder, making him do a half-spin around. The second strikes him in the side as he turns.

    Tireas drives his sword down, a pair of quick slashes severing the bandit king's hamstrings. He crashes to his knees, roaring in pain now. Zinovia's flame bursts against his chest, and a moment later, Viktor thrusts his heavy blade – still burning with justice – through his chest. On his knees, the Stag Lord grunts, his hands clutching at the weapon, a rattling rasp escaping his evil helm.

    "You... can't... kill me... She said... I cannot... die."

    As if some unearthly power has taken hold, or perhaps just from sheer will to live, one of the Stag Lord's blood drenched gloves grasps for his fallen sword. He somehow pushes himself off the ground, struggling to stand, rage in his eyes as he collapses back down onto one knee. With a roar, he swings his blade.

    "I will... not die!"

    It catches with a clang on Katerina's duelling sword. The Swordlord protege twists it aside, spinning in close as the king of the Stolen Lands rises up again, every muscle in his massive body straining to survive, his dim eyes blazing. Her sword whips around, stabbing through his throat to the hilt. A wave of deep red blood washes down his neck. He slips from the blade, falling limply to the ground of his fortress.

    A hand rises, fingers groping, clawing at the dirt. It grasps at nothing, closes, then falls. All is silent and still, except the flutter of ragged stag's head banners in the cool spring wind that rushes in from the east. The field is littered with the fallen, bathed in the red-orange light of the slowly setting sun. The Stag Lord, the terror and sovereign master of the Greenbelt, is dead.

    The first night of real peace passes without incident. The fortress roof is far from well maintained, and so dawn's light streams in golden beams through the chinks and holes in the old keep.

    Vasily volunteers to take a horse and the letters north to Oleg's to inform them of your victory. He rides out the gates with a grin on his face. "You'll all be damn heroes when you get back, you know. As for me, hey, "ain't gonna get executed" works." He leaves with a whoop and a clatter of horse's hooves.

    You begin the rather more grim work of burying the bodies. Akiros cuts each bandit's name into a plank of wood, and they're laid down into a single grave. The Stag Lord is the last to go in. His former lieutenant hesitates, carving knife in hand. He shakes his bearded head and writes nothing. "Doesn't have a name, and he isn't the lord of anything anymore," he explains gruffly.

    Grigori gets his own grave, dug into the ground beneath a nearby tree. The priest's holy symbol is lain out over the turned earth when all is said and done. Akiros has taken a rock from the rubble of the fort and chiseled Grigori's name onto it. The slab of uniform grey rock is thrust into the ground beside the grave.

    An hour later, with all preparations made, you are riding across the open fields of the Kamelands, heading north, feeling the heat of the late spring sun shining down on you.

    22 Desnus, 4708

    The next day sees you back to Oleg's Post. As you approach the walls, Kesten's detachment of Brevish guards cheer, lifting their helmets from their heads in recognition.

    Inside, Oleg claps each of you on the shoulder as you enter and dismount, the usually-taciturn man so much as smiling jovially. Svetlana hugs everyone – even Zinovia.

    Celebrations commence for a few minutes. Someone has brought out a fiddle, and a few hunters begin to sing a rowdy, ironic, and off-key rendition of 'the Defeat of Estruan Aldori.' But then, as quickly as the celebrations have begun, a hush falls over the crowd: Kesten Garress is turning towards the source of the commotion, saluting stiffly. Oleg scowls slightly, and Vasily seem to shrink visibly.

    At the gates, a column of perhaps a dozen soldiers is riding into the Post's courtyard, each in a uniform of red-iron chain, their breastplates embossed with a pair of crossed duelling swords.

    At the head of the column are three figures: In the lead is a tall, lean woman with dusky skin. Her black hair is tied back in a warrior's knot, and her sharp brown eyes seem to take in everything without looking right at it. Slightly pointed ears attest to elven heritage somewhere in her bloodline. She wears a suit of mithral armour – all bands of the silvery metal – that flows down to to her knees. A long Aldori blade is sheathed at her side. She rides with an air of imperial command, holding up a hand to bring the column to a halt.

    The other two figures are similarly armed. One is a middle-aged man, his light brown hair greying at the temples, who wears a silken robe, tied with a wide sash, in which his sword's sheathe is held. His blue eyes are calm and collected, but with a mirthful shine to them. The other is a woman with short blonde hair, a long scar on one side of her face, and red leather armour on the rest of her.
